Notes:(1) As of 6/30/2018 the net OPEB liability is $13.1 million. This fund maintains the balance identified for this liability.(2) This Internal Service Fund was established in 2007. Prior to GASB 45, the financial statement reported only the amount paid in the current fiscal year for retiree benefits. Under GASB 75, implemented as required in 2017/2018, the district is required to report 100% of the net OPEB liability.(3) This Fund accounts for funds transferred from the general operating fund to address the actuarial liability, as follows: (a) Current employees costs - beginning in fiscal year 2011/2012, the district is allocating current costs to program budgets along with other employee benefit costs. This allocation was .5% in 11/12 and 12/13, 1% in 13/14, 1.5% in 14/15. The allocation will increase to 2% in 15/16 and will be capped at 2% until further analysis is conducted. (b) Unfunded prior liability - beginning in fiscal year 2013/2014, 10% of site unrestricted general fund ending balances are transferred in to address the current unfunded balance.
